Jimy 6 years ago
parent
commit
b0345c5718

+ 0 - 153
application/admin/controller/Accesskf.php

@@ -1,153 +0,0 @@
-<?php
-
-namespace app\admin\controller;
-
-use think\Validate;
-use think\Lang;
-
-class Accesskf extends AdminControl
-{
-
-    public function _initialize()
-    {
-        parent::_initialize();
-        Lang::load(APP_PATH . 'admin/lang/' . config('default_lang') . '/member.lang.php');
-    }
-
-    /**
-     * 客户接入列表
-     * @return mixed
-     */
-    public function index()
-    {
-        $model_Access = Model('Access');
-        $title = input('post.title');
-        $condition = array();
-        if($title){
-            $condition['access_gsjrname|access_gsname|access_appid'] = $title;
-        }
-        $access_list = $model_Access->getAccessList($condition, '*', 10);
-        if($access_list){
-            for ($i=0; $i < count($access_list); $i++) { 
-                $where['member_id'] = $access_list[$i]["access_pid"];
-                $member_list[] = model('member')->getMemberInfo($where,$field = 'member_name');
-            }
-            $this->assign('member_list',$member_list);
-        }
-        $allpower = $this->qxhans();
-        $this->assign('allpower',$allpower);
-        $this->assign('access_list', $access_list);
-        $this->assign('show_page', $model_Access->page_info->render());
-        $this->setAdminCurItem('index');
-        return $this->fetch();
-    }
-
-    /**
-     * 添加用户
-     * @return mixed
-     */
-    public function add()
-    {
-        if (request()->isPost()) {
-            $model_access = Model('access');
-            //判断用户名是否存在
-            if ($model_access->getAccessInfo(['access_gsjrname' => input('post.access_gsjrname')])) {
-                $this->error("接入用户名已存在");
-            }
-            $data = array(
-                'access_gsjrname' => input('post.access_gsjrname'),
-                'access_pid' => input('post.access_pid'),
-                'access_gsname' => input('post.access_gsname'),
-                'access_url' => input('post.access_url'),
-                'access_appid' => random(22,0).time(),
-                'access_appsecrect' => random(32,0),
-                'access_addtime' => TIMESTAMP,
-            );
-            //添加到数据库
-            $result = $model_access->addAccess($data);
-            if ($result) {
-                dsLayerOpenSuccess("接入添加成功!");
-            } else {
-                $this->error("接入添加失败!");
-            }
-        } else {
-            $member_array = array(
-                'member_status' => 0,
-                'add' => 1,
-            );
-            $onlygs = array(
-                'member_id'=>'',
-                'member_name'=>'',
-            );
-            $allgs = Model('member')->allcompany('');
-            $this->assign('allgs',$allgs);
-            $this->assign('onlygs',$onlygs);
-            $this->assign('member', $member_array);
-            $this->setAdminCurItem('add');
-            return $this->fetch('form');
-        }
-    }
-
-    public function edit()
-    {
-        $access_id = input('param.access_id');
-        if (empty($access_id)) {
-            $this->error(lang('param_error'));
-        }
-        $model_access = Model('Access');
-        if (!request()->isPost()) {
-            $condition['access_id'] = $access_id;
-            $access_array = $model_access->getAccessInfo($condition);
-            $access_array['add'] = 0;
-            $allgs = Model('member')->allcompany('');
-            $where['member_id'] = $access_array['access_pid'];
-            $onlygs = Model('member')->getMemberInfo($where,$field = 'member_id,member_name');
-            $this->assign('onlygs',$onlygs);
-            $this->assign('allgs',$allgs);
-            $this->assign('access', $access_array);
-            $this->setAdminCurItem('edit');
-            return $this->fetch('form');
-        } else {
-            $data = array(
-                'access_gsjrname' => input('post.access_gsjrname'),
-                'access_pid' => input('post.access_pid'),
-                'access_gsname' => input('post.access_gsname'),
-                'access_url' => input('post.access_url'),
-            );
-            //验证数据  END
-            $result = $model_access->editAccess(array('access_id' => intval($access_id)), $data);
-            if ($result) {
-                dsLayerOpenSuccess("接入编辑成功!");
-            } else {
-                $this->error("接入编辑失败!");
-            }
-        }
-    }
-
-    public function del()
-    {
-        $access_id = input('param.access_id');
-        if (empty($access_id)) {
-            $this->error(lang('param_error'));
-        }
-        $result = db('Access')->delete($access_id);
-        if ($result) {
-            ds_json_encode(10000, "删除成功");
-        } else {
-            ds_json_encode(10001, "删除失败");
-        }
-    }
-
-    protected function getAdminItemList()
-    {
-        $menu_array = array(
-            array(
-                'name' => 'index', 'text' => lang('ds_manage'), 'url' => url('Accesskf/index')
-            ), array(
-                'name' => 'add', 'text' => lang('ds_add'), 'url' => "javascript:dsLayerOpen('".url('Accesskf/add')."','".lang('ds_add')."')"
-            ),
-        );
-        return $menu_array;
-    }
-
-}

+ 0 - 4
application/admin/controller/AdminControl.php

@@ -167,10 +167,6 @@ class AdminControl extends Controller
                         'text' => lang('ds_member'),
                         'url' => url('Member/index'),
                     ),
-                    'accesskf' => array(
-                        'text' => lang('ds_accesskf'),
-                        'url' =>url('Accesskf/index'),
-                    ),
                     'admin' => array(
                         'text' => lang('ds_admin'),
                         'url' => url('Admin/index'),

+ 0 - 7
application/admin/controller/Admingroup.php

@@ -199,13 +199,6 @@ class Admingroup extends AdminControl
                 array('name' => lang('ds_edmember'), 'action' => "edit", 'controller' => 'Member'),
                 array('name' => lang('ds_dlmember'), 'action' => "del", 'controller' => 'Member'),
             )),
-            array('name' => "接入设置", 'child' => array(
-                array('name' => "接入设置", 'action' => null, 'controller' => 'Accesskf'),
-                array('name' => "接入列表", 'action' => "index", 'controller' => 'Accesskf'),
-                array('name' => "接入添加", 'action' => "add", 'controller' => 'Accesskf'),
-                array('name' => "接入编辑", 'action' => "edit", 'controller' => 'Accesskf'),
-                array('name' => "接入删除", 'action' => "del", 'controller' => 'Accesskf'),
-            )),
             array('name' => lang('ds_admin'), 'child' => array(
                 array('name' => lang('ds_admin'), 'action' => null, 'controller' => 'Admin'),
                 array('name' => lang('ds_gladmin'), 'action' => "index", 'controller' => 'Admin'),

+ 0 - 1
application/admin/lang/zh-cn.php

@@ -80,7 +80,6 @@ $lang['ds_adminczlog'] = '操作日志';
 //会员管理
 $lang['ds_personnel_manage'] = '用户管理';
 $lang['ds_member'] = '客户列表';
-$lang['ds_accesskf'] = '客户接入设置';
 $lang['ds_glmember'] = '会员管理';
 $lang['ds_addmember'] = '会员添加';
 $lang['ds_edmember'] = '会员编辑';

+ 0 - 59
application/admin/view/accesskf/form.html

@@ -1,59 +0,0 @@
-{extend name="layout:home" /}
-
-{block name="container"}
-<form class="layui-form layui-form-pane" method="post">
-    <div class="layui-tab layui-tab-card">
-        <div class="layui-tab-content page-tab-content">
-            <div class="layui-tab-item layui-show ">
-                <div class="layui-form-item">
-                    <label class="layui-form-label">所属客户</label>
-                    <div class="layui-input-inline">
-                        <select name="access_pid" id="access_pid">
-                            <option value="{$onlygs.member_id}">{if $onlygs}{$onlygs.member_name}{else}请选择所属客户{/if}</option>
-                            {foreach name="allgs" id="v"}
-                                <option value="{$v.member_id}">{$v.member_name}</option>
-                            {/foreach}
-                        </select>
-                    </div>
-                </div>
-                <div class="layui-form-item">
-                    <label class="layui-form-label">公司名</label>
-                    <div class="layui-input-block">
-                        <input type="text" class="layui-input field-name" name="access_gsname" id="access_gsname" value="{$access.access_gsname|default=''}" lay-verify="access_gsname" autocomplete="off" placeholder="{:lang('ds_please_enter')}公司名" required />
-                    </div>
-                </div>
-                <div class="layui-form-item">
-                    <label class="layui-form-label">接入名称</label>
-                    <div class="layui-input-block">
-                        <input type="text" class="layui-input field-name" name="access_gsjrname" id="access_gsjrname" value="{$access.access_gsjrname|default=''}"  placeholder="{:lang('ds_please_enter')}接入名称" />
-                    </div>
-                </div>
-                <div class="layui-form-item">
-                    <label class="layui-form-label">域名</label>
-                    <div class="layui-input-block">
-                        <input type="text" class="layui-input field-name" name="access_url" id="access_url" value="{$access.access_url|default=''}"  placeholder="{:lang('ds_please_enter')}域名" lay-verify="domainName"/>
-                    </div>
-                </div>
-                <div class="layui-form-item">
-                    <div class="layui-input-block">
-                        <input type="submit" class="layui-btn layui-btn-normal" lay-submit value="{:lang('ds_submit')}" />
-                    </div>
-                </div>
-            </div>
-        </div>
-    </div>
-</form>
-<script>
-    layui.use('form', function() {
-        var form = layui.form;
-    });
-	$('#access_url').blur(function(){
-		if(!/^(?=^.{3,255}$)()?(www\.)?[a-zA-Z0-9][-a-zA-Z0-9]{0,62}(\.[a-zA-Z0-9][-a-zA-Z0-9]{0,62})+(:\d+)*(\/\w+\.\w+)*$/.test($('#access_url').val())){
-			layer.msg('域名格式不正确');
-		}
-	})
-</script>
-{/block}
-
-
-

+ 0 - 83
application/admin/view/accesskf/index.html

@@ -1,83 +0,0 @@
-{extend name="layout:home" /}
-{block name="container"}
-<div class="layui-tab layui-tab-card">
-    {include file="layout/admin_items" /}
-    <div class="layui-tab-content page-tab-content">
-        <!-- 搜索框开始 -->
-        <div class="search-form">
-        <form class="" method="post">
-            <div class="layui-form-item">
-                <div class="layui-inline">
-                    <input type="text" name="title"  placeholder="输入公司名或appid或接入名" autocomplete="off" class="layui-input">
-                </div>
-                <div class="layui-inline">
-                    <button type="submit" class="layui-btn search-subBtn">搜索</button>
-                </div>
-            </div>
-        </form>
-        </div>
-        <!-- 搜索框结束 -->
-        <table class="layui-table lay-even">
-            <colgroup>
-                <col width="150">
-                <col width="200">
-                <col>
-            </colgroup>
-            <thead>
-            <tr>
-                <th>公司名</th>
-                <th>接入名称</th>
-                <th>appid</th>
-                <th>appsecrect</th>
-                <th>域名</th>
-                <th>所属公司</th>
-                <th>操作</th>
-            </tr>
-            </thead>
-            <tbody>
-            {if $access_list}
-            {volist name="access_list" id="access" key="k"}
-            <tr>
-                <td>{$access.access_gsname}</td>
-                <td>{$access.access_gsjrname}</td>
-                <td>{$access.access_appid}</td>
-                <td>{$access.access_appsecrect}</td>
-                <td>{$access.access_url}</td>
-                <td>{$member_list[$k-1]['member_name']}</td>
-                <td>
-                    {if array_intersect(explode(" ",str_replace("/", ".","accesskf/edit")),$allpower)}
-                        <a href="javascript:dsLayerOpen('{:url('Accesskf/edit',['access_id'=>$access.access_id])}','{$Think.lang.ds_edit}-{$access.access_gsname}')" class="layui-btn layui-btn-xs"><i class="layui-icon layui-icon-edit"></i>{$Think.lang.ds_edit}</a>
-                    {/if}
-                    {if array_intersect(explode(" ",str_replace("/", ".","accesskf/del")),$allpower)}
-                        <a href="javascript:dsLayerConfirm('{:url('Accesskf/del',['access_id'=>$access.access_id])}','{$Think.lang.member_confirm_del}')" class="layui-btn layui-btn-xs layui-btn-danger"><i class="layui-icon layui-icon-delete"></i>删除</a>
-                    {/if}
-                </td>
-            </tr>
-            {/volist}
-            {else}
-            <td>无数据</td>
-            {/if}
-            </tbody>
-        </table>
-        {$show_page}
-    </div>
-</div>
-<script type="text/javascript">
-    layui.use('laydate', function(){
-      var laydate = layui.laydate;
-      
-      //执行一个laydate实例
-      laydate.render({
-        elem: '#creatTime' //指定元素
-      });
-        laydate.render({
-            elem:'#timeRang',
-            range:true,
-            format: 'yyyy/MM/dd',
-            done: function(value, date){
-                /* 时间选择完成后的回调 */
-            }
-        })
-    });
-</script>
-{/block}